Summary During trying times like the one we're experiencing now, people push back against the changing tides, and often, Black women represent those changing tides. All leaders have challenges and obstacles that they must overcome to lead effectively, but for Black women leading legacy organizations in philanthropy, those challenges are unique. In this talk with Ms Foundation CEO Teresa C. Younger, you will learn: * More about what leadership at a legacy foundation looks like * Insight about the unique challenges of being a Black woman in leadership * Why it's so important for women of color to lead organizations like Ms. during this tumultuous time This talk is facilitated by Berrett-Koehler Publisher and President Johanna Vondeling as part of the Women's Leadership Online Summit produced by Berrett-Koehler Publishers.
